What Is the Role of Crepe Paper in Wet Wipe Production?
Crepe paper is a controlled-deformation material offering high cross-directional elasticity, good absorbency, and excellent handling in automated production lines. These features make it a suitable base substrate for specific wet wipe formats, especially in industrial, professional hygiene, and technical cleaning sectors. Thanks to its micro-crimped texture, it improves liquid retention and facilitates the impregnation of wetting solutions.

What Materials Compete with Crepe Paper in Wet Wipe Manufacturing?
In the wet wipe sector, crepe paper is commonly compared with three major material families:
1. Synthetic Nonwovens
Primarily made from polyester, polypropylene, or viscose blends.
Advantages:
- Excellent wet strength
- Dimensional stability
- Smooth and uniform texture
Disadvantages:
- Lower environmental sustainability
- Difficult to recycle
- Petrochemical-based
2. Cellulose-Based Nonwovens
Made from natural or regenerated fibers such as viscose or lyocell.
Advantages:
- High softness
- Good absorbency
- Improved environmental profile vs. synthetics
Limitations:
- Higher cost
- Complex manufacturing processes
- Lower initial stiffness compared to technical papers

Technical Comparison: Crepe Paper vs. Other Substrates
Elasticity and Production Line Behavior
Crepe paper offers natural cross-directional elasticity and is ideal for lines requiring tension control and adaptability.
Synthetic nonwovens provide unidirectional strength but are less flexible.
Absorption and Liquid Impregnation
- Crepe paper: Quick wetting and strong retention
- Tissue gauze & embossed paper: Increase volume and absorption
- Synthetic nonwovens: Good absorbency with viscose, lower with 100% synthetics
Wet Strength
Synthetic materials provide higher absolute wet strength.
Crepe paper and specialty papers can enhance this through reinforcement treatments or layered structures.

Material Applications in the Wet Wipe Sector
Crepe Paper
Ideal for:
- Industrial wet wipes for machinery and equipment cleaning
- Professional wipes used in technical maintenance
- Products requiring high impregnation and moderate strength
Synthetic Nonwovens
Best suited for:
- Cosmetic or hygiene wet wipes needing maximum softness
- Applications with intense wet mechanical stress

Practical Use Cases of Crepe Paper in Wet Wipes
Case 1: Machinery Cleaning Wipes
Crepe paper with reinforcement is used to absorb light lubricants and ensure stable performance in emulsified environments.
Case 2: Professional Maintenance Wipes
A blend of tissue gauze and technical paper balances absorption and durability.
Case 3: Specialty Impregnated Wipes
Polyethylene paper acts as a partial barrier, or paraffin paper is used for oil-based applications.
FAQs – Materials for Wet Wipes
Can crepe paper fully replace nonwovens in wet wipes?
It depends on the application. For industrial uses, crepe paper is an effective alternative. For cosmetics or intimate hygiene, nonwovens offer greater softness.
What is the most sustainable material for wet wipe production?
FSC®-certified specialty papers offer the best combination of performance and sustainability.
Can different specialty papers be combined in a single wet wipe?
Yes, multilayer structures allow hybrid solutions with distinct functional layers.
